Enrolment Services Specialist

2 weeks ago


Saskatchewan, Canada Saskatchewan Polytechnic Full time

Job Duties/Qualifications, Skills and Abilities (QSA)

Job Duties:

  • Provides information, services, and support regarding application, admission requirements, registration, grading, transfer credit, fees, student loans, and more.
  • Reviews and assesses applications for admission to ensure they meet program requirements.
  • Collaborates with programs to manage enrollment levels.
  • Creates course sections, registers students, and handles tuition fees and refunds.
  • Produces official transcripts and program completion documentation.
  • Works with various departments to enhance student services.
  • Maintains student records and enforces institutional policies.
  • May require a criminal record check and occasional travel.

Required Qualifications, Skills, Abilities, and Experience:

  • Grade 12 with an office education diploma, business diploma, or equivalent.
  • Two years of recent administrative experience.
  • Data input proficiency and intermediate computer skills.
  • Effective communication and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ong organizational abilities and teamwork.
  • Experience in payment processing and policy application.
  • Ability to handle difficult situations and value diversity.
